The Great Glue Debate: Silicone vs. Epoxy Showdown

Choosing adhesive is like picking a dating app - get it wrong and you'll regret it. Here's the solar repair cheat sheet:

UV-Resistant Silicone Sealants

  • Pros: Flexible, weatherproof, easy application
  • Cons: Not for structural repairs
  • Hot Tip: Dow Corning 732 works like solar duct tape

Solar-Specific Epoxy Resins

  • Pros: Industrial-strength bonds, fills cracks
  • Cons: Requires precise mixing
  • Pro Hack: 3M DP8005 turns you into instant solar surgeon

The Leak Repair Dance: 7 Steps That Won't Make You Look Clumsy

  1. Safety first! Disconnect the system like it's bomb disposal work
  2. Clean the area with isopropyl alcohol - no half-hearted wiping!
  3. Apply adhesive using the "Peanut Butter Principle" - enough to seal, not enough to ooze
  4. Clamp it like you're hugging a fragile grandma
  5. Cure time matters more than Netflix's next hit show
  6. Test with a multimeter - because guessing is for horoscopes
  7. Weatherproofing: Add sealant armor around the repair

When DIY Becomes "Don't Injure Yourself"

Remember that Colorado rancher who used super glue on 40 panels? His repair lasted exactly... until next rainfall. The $2,800 lesson? Match adhesive thermal expansion rates to panel materials. Pro tip: Check the CTE (Coefficient of Thermal Expansion) rating - it's not just alphabet soup!

The Billion-Dollar Question: Does This Void My Warranty?

Most manufacturers get twitchy about unauthorized repairs. But here's a loophole: Document everything like you're building a legal case. Photos, repair logs, material specs - turn your DIY project into an insurance policy.
